Supply Chain Planning Optimization in the Fruit Industry

This paper presents a midterm tactical planning model for the supply chain of a typical large company operating in the High Valley of the Black and Neuquén Rivers area of Argentina. A Mixed Integer Lineal Programming model has been developed, which maximizes the net profit of the company along a one-year time horizon divided in twelve monthly periods. Based on customer orders from three major markets, estimated fruit production, economic information about costs and prices, and yield and availability of processing plants, the model optimally allocates plant operation levels, amount and place where raw material should be obtained and a monthly plan for fruit cold storage and final product delivery. The model has about 14300 continuous variables and 3300 discrete variables. Results are presented for an one year optimal operation of a typical company in the region under study.
